[gtk/matthiasc/for-master: 3/5] imcontext: Add a precondition check




commit e39b5c99f1592b792206fb3b5da857b0ed41855a
Author: Matthias Clasen <mclasen redhat com>
Date:   Mon Feb 1 00:43:44 2021 -0500

    imcontext: Add a precondition check

 gtk/gtkimcontextsimple.c | 1 +
 1 file changed, 1 insertion(+)
---
diff --git a/gtk/gtkimcontextsimple.c b/gtk/gtkimcontextsimple.c
index 21db7d04b3..76afa8c1ee 100644
--- a/gtk/gtkimcontextsimple.c
+++ b/gtk/gtkimcontextsimple.c
@@ -1320,6 +1320,7 @@ gtk_im_context_simple_add_table (GtkIMContextSimple *context_simple,
                                 int                 n_seqs)
 {
   g_return_if_fail (GTK_IS_IM_CONTEXT_SIMPLE (context_simple));
+  g_return_if_fail (max_seq_len <= GTK_MAX_COMPOSE_LEN);
 
   G_LOCK (global_tables);
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]